How often should you get a four wheel alignment?

  • For a 2020 Hyundai Tucson, check alignment at least once a year or after hitting significant potholes, curb strikes, or after suspension work.
  • Regular inspections during routine maintenance help catch drift early, protecting tire life and steering precision.

What is included in a 2020 Hyundai Tucson alignment service?

  • A full four-wheel alignment includes measurement and adjustment of toe, camber, and caster to OEM specs, road test verification, and a written alignment report.

How do you know if your wheels need alignment?

  • Signs include uneven or rapid tire wear, pulling to one side, a crooked steering wheel at straight-ahead, or vibrations at highway speeds.

Ignoring regular four wheel alignments can cause rapid, uneven tire wear, reduced fuel economy, and steering instability — problems that quickly add repair and replacement costs. Missing alignment needs also places extra stress on wheel bearings and suspension components, potentially turning a modest alignment fee into a costly repair.
